Aussie scientists create lamb mince in a laboratory

6PR BREAKFAST
Article image for Aussie scientists create lamb mince in a laboratory

Would you eat meat and milk in a lab?

Australian scientists have made a major breakthrough in the space of ethical food production by creating lamb mince in a laboratory.

Magic Valley Research’s Andrew Laslett tells 6PR Breakfast it was done using a small sample of skin cells.

“We’re not making lamb chops yet, that might be five years down the track,” he told stand-in Breakfast hosts Lisa Barnes and Mark Gibson.
